“...”


“What is that?”


‘This creature keeps getting weirder by the second.’ Snatcher pointed to the approaching bot.


She huffed and patted the frightened little bot. "It's a robot. Its function is to be a vacuum cleaner. But judging from its characteristics, it also serves as a sort of pet." She pointed out the little eyes and how it beeps like in a language.


“A pet robot? Weird..” He commented floating towards where his treehouse was.


"It sounds weird but when you've seen as much shit as I have, you learn to live with it." She said as she wobbled behind him till they reached a giant hollowed out tree. She gazed in wonder as she saw the golden warm glow coming from the home. It looked so homey and fantastic looking.


“Don’t stand and gawk, even I have style.” Snatcher mused to the woman.


She blinked and blushed a little bit. She hobbled up the giant tree roots and promptly fell to the floor. The adrenaline was wearing off so the literal pain in her side was coming back tenfold. She looked at the injury and cringed at the sight. It was a bloody mess. She wanted to use her own magical abilities to heal it, but she didn't know what the Spector would do if he found out. She laid her backpack down and activated the pods' hovering feature. With a press of a hidden button, the little pod hovered in place.


Snatcher frowned. ‘How had I not noticed that she was wounded?’ He was about to go help her out before the pod did its “floaty thing” as he thought to call it. It made him all the more curious. “What else can that thing do?”


"... It's a safety pod. It helps protect and provides for those who need to escape or seek protection from enemies. It also provides one to sleep in it in cryo sleep if necessary. Only those who have permission by the person in the pod or those in charge of that person are allowed to keep or take it with them while the person is sleeping. The hovering feature is just something that allows other people to easily carry with them. Seeing as how the larger ones are pretty heavy." She raised a brow at him in question. "Are you going to tell me where your medical kit is? Or do I have to find it myself?"


“Right. No. You are going to relax so you don’t lose more blood and I’ll fix up your wound. You’ve got someone in that pod, correct?” At least, that’s what he presumed from her explanation.


She looked uneasy. Should she tell him? Snatcher seemed to sense her apprehension and her tense and guarded look on her face.


“Agh. Never mind, your appearance says it all.” He picked her up and propped her on his chair before going off to get something. Soon he returned with a vial in hand. “Drink this… I promise it's not poison.”


She gently grabbed it and popped the cork off it. She gave it a sniff and seemed to slightly gag at it. She channeled a brief bit of magic to her eyes and took a peek at the contents. Her sight showed that she didn't recognize any of the ingredients in it. But her senses told her that it wasn't poison. So with hesitance, she gulped it all in one go. She nearly threw up at the taste but held it in as she coughed a few times. "P-potent…"


“The more potent the potion, the stronger the effects. It should be healed by tomorrow now.” Snatcher replied simply.


She coughed a few more times before she was able to clear her throat. Then, as she was about to ask something, the pod beeped little alerts and there were quiet little thumps against the inside of the pod.


Snatcher blinked. “Your little creature wants out.” He put the pod next to her, assuming she didn’t really want him touching it too much.


"..."


She chuckled as she processed his comment. She removed the lid and saw the crying toddler, who wanted to run around and cause havoc.


"Shhh, shhh, shhh…. It's okay Hattie… we're safe… for now." The woman cooed softly as she took out the small girl from out of the pod and began to rub soothing circles on her back. The child began to calm down, but she kept whimpering.


Snatcher watched quietly. ‘How long has it been since there was a kid here of all places? Is she the mother?’ That thought brought a strange sense of hurt to him that he didn’t understand. He shook it off quickly. “Is she hungry? I’m hungry.”


She smirked. "Well you're not the one crying your little heart out because you have no idea on what to eat. Or how to do it." She quipped.


Snatcher narrowed his eyes a bit in irritation and was about to say something but someone beat him to it.


"Mmmmmm!!!! Widia!!! Hwungwy!!!! It hurt!!!" The child known as Hattie complained.


The woman smiled. "I know. Hold on, let me get your food." She gestured for Snatcher to hand her her bag.


“...”


Snatcher sighed and retrieved the bag. ‘I’m going to regret this, aren’t I?’


He sent the bag next to her. She reached down and opened it up to reveal a black emptiness of an abyss. She reached in till her entire arm seemed to be engulfed by the bag. "Now where is…. AH-HA!!! THERE YOU ARE!" She pulled out a purple jar and put it on the small table that was in front of her. She then continued her search in the bag till she found a bottle of milk, a spoon and a small bowl.


She put the child down carefully on the floor while she opened and poured the purple and fruity smelling goop into the bowl and screwed the lid back on. She turned to Hattie and smiled amusingly at the happy clapping of the hungry toddler.


"Okay Hattie, despite our situation, our little routine still stands. What's my name~?"


"Widia! Widia!! Widia!!!" She cheered with her hands thrown up in the air in excitement.


The woman chuckled. "And what's your name?"


"Hairwiet Tymmarck!!!" She replied boldly and filled with pride as she beat her little chest like a tiny gorilla.


The woman rolled her eyes in amusement. "And how old are you today?"


The toddler seemed to blink owlishly until she counted on her small fingers. "I'm thwee!!!" She cheered happily as she seemed to figure it out.


"I'll have to remind myself to have you rewatch those math videos…" the woman mumbled. "Alright! Ready?"


Hattie nodded wildly and already opened her mouth for the food. The woman chuckled. "Here comes the spaceship~" she made little engine noises with the spoon filled with the baby food and gently stuck it in the toddler's mouth.


The toddler in turn hummed in happiness. "Ah, ah, ah!!!" The toddler cooed as she wanted more. The woman laughed and continued to feed her till she was full.  


Snatcher had gotten himself something to eat, after their little teaching session. “So… Widia I assume is Lydia and Hairwiet must mean Harriet. Pleasure.”


Lydia raised an amused brow at the ghost. "Yes, you are correct. My name is Lydia Starlight and this little one is Harriet Timmark. Also known as Hattie. Hattie say hello."


The small child finally paid attention from messing with her hair to finally paying attention to the Spector. Snatcher at first thought she was going to cry in fright. But that was further from the truth.


She beamed up at him with child-like curiosity and made grabby hands for him. "Up, up, up!!!" She yelled/demanded.


Snatcher hesitated a moment before picking the child up. “Is she your offspring?” He wondered out loud.


Lydia seemed to choke on air and coughed violently until she cleared her throat. "W-what?! N-no! I'm her nanny!" She blushed as thousands of embarrassing thoughts and memories of people saying that she was and/or asking if she was the mother countless times. Snatcher seemed… relieved? While the child seemed like this was nothing new to her and buried her face in his neck floof.


"Afaa, faa, faa!!!!" She seemed to chant happily in his floof.


“I see. What do you need help with… other than the wound?” Snatcher questioned, holding Hattie closer instinctively.


Harriet clutched his floof in her hands and continued to squeal in delight at the softness. Meanwhile with Lydia, she managed to shake out of her embarrassment and coughed to get her voice straight.


"Y-yes. Since we landed here on this planet, we need a place to stay. And I only have resources for us for a few weeks. The ships we came in are destroyed. And since this planet was in the restricted area, there are no repair or fueling stations. So even if it was possible to try to fix the escape ship, I wouldn't be able to. Also when the original ship exploded, the fuel source was scattered across the planet. It's crucial that I retrieve them as soon as possible. Or else things might get messy. So the list consists of food, clothing, other resources, a residence, an extra hand in watching Hattie, and most importantly, protection." She explained.


“Mafia Town and Metro City will have shops for resources and clothing. I am providing residence and food which you could also go to Cooking Cat, and…” He sighed. “I suppose I can help with Harriet.. If you don’t trust me with her, The Conductor has lots of experience with children.” He listed people and places she could go for what she needed. All the while he’d started rocking Hattie.


Lydia nodded and seemed to soak up the information like a sponge. "Alright. Well, I need all the help I can get. And since you're willing to let us stay with you… I suppose I can trust you enough to let you babysit Hattie while I try to retrieve the fuel sources." She smiled amusingly at the sight. "The only thing that I ask is your planets' leader's permission to stay here and have total protection."


He chuckled. “Our planet doesn’t have one specific leader. There are divisions to this planet, led by different leaders.” Snatcher replied.


"Are you one of them by chance? And if so, what is the guarantee of protection provided?" Lydia asked carefully. Snatcher raised a curious brow. She kept mentioning "protection". But from what?


“... What do you need protection from? Does it have something to do with the “war” you’d mentioned earlier?”


"Yes… our allies from our sister planet betrayed us and started a war. I was barely able to escape with Hattie alive. I'm a commander of our military forces and close friend with my commanding general. The King, my and the General's boss, ordered/hired me to be his daughter's nanny, teacher, mentor, trainer, and bodyguard. As to whether the King himself or any of the other commanding officers, or even the people I was close to, I have no idea if they are even alive. The attack was sudden and abrupt…. I am not sure if we will even be found by rescue ships, little alone go back home and resume my life. That is yet to be seen." She reported like the soldier she was.


Snatcher nodded slowly, absorbing the information given. "I can guarantee your protection… inside and outside my forest.." The thought of leaving his forest made him uneasy, but he felt like he HAD to keep Lydia and in extension Hattie safe.


Lydia breathed a sigh of relief. "Thank you. That helps us more than you know." She then raised an amused brow at how Hattie was dozing off in the Ghost's floof. "You want to hand her over so you can pull out a bed for us to sleep in? Or are you fine with both of us sleeping with you on your chair?" She teased as she saw no other bed in sight but seeing the ghost's face turn yellow.


"U-uh- spectors don't actually need sleep! Th-the chair is yours.." He replied, mentally cursing himself for stuttering as he passed the child off to Lydia. "And..you're welcome. I'm going to inform the others of your stay here at Subcon Forest. There's one place you should avoid if you explore. A lonely old mansion at the edge of the woods."


Lydia wanted to question the ghost's warning but was too tired to argue.


"Alright then. Goodnight." She took Hattie and herself and settled in the chair. Both of which fell instantly asleep.


Snatcher's POV


One of the minions peeked its little head in as it saw their boss staring at the sleeping females. And just like in a cartoon, more minions climbed on top of each other who also stared at the strange sight.


"Boss. If you keep staring like that, it'll look like you're a peeping Tom or a creep." Minion 1 stated bluntly.


He shot a glare towards them. "WHO asked YOU?" I hissed quietly as not to disturb them. In fact, I should probably leave the house for this chat. It may get loud.


Snatcher moved from out of his tree home and moved a decent distance away with his minions following him. Once he thought he was safe, he turned and glared at them.


"What were you even doing there! What do you want?" He commanded, volume already increased.


The minions flinched. Well, except minion 1. If they had an actual face, they'd probably have a neutral expression.


"..."


"Weren't you the one that said you were going to tell us something? And besides, your battle with the lady was pretty funny. Been awhile since I've seen someone give you the runaround, huh?" They mused.


"Oh shut up!" Snatcher snapped. "I didn't mean that I was going to tell you THERE, you imbecile!"


They simply shrugged. "Well either way, some of us are here now. Just tell us and we'll tell the others." They honestly didn't look scared whatsoever by him. The others pretty much hid behind them in fright. They were probably one of the few that was. In fact, they almost looked amused at his frustrated state.


"...."


He sighed and decided it wasn't worth it for the moment. "That girl is off limits. Her, the child, and the pet bot. I want her protected. And if she goes near HER mansion, I want to know. Understood?"


The little minion stood up straight and mock saluted. "Aye, aye, captain creeper!" They giggled as they and the others scurried off while Snatcher roared at them.


"I AM NOT A CREEPER!!!"


"..."


"When the hell did any of you grow a pair anyway?" He muttered to himself.
